Septimius Severus. AD 193-211. AV Aureus (20mm, 7.23 g, 12h). Rome mint. Struck AD 196-197. L SEPT SEV PERT AVG IMP VIII, laureate, draped, and cuirassed bust right / ADVENTVI AVG FELI CISSIMO, Septimius on horseback right, cuirassed with mantle over his shoulder, raising his right arm in salute; to right, soldier advancing right, head left, wearing helmet and cuirass, holding reins of horse with his right hand and vexillum with his left. RIC IV 73 var. (obv. bust type); Calicó 2427 (same dies as illustration); BMCRE 150 var. (same); Biaggi 1061(same dies). Lustrous, a couple light marks in reverse field. EF. Rare and interesting type – Septimius entering Rome for his adventus after his eastern campaigns against Pescennius Niger.

From the Weise Collection. Ex Freeman & Sear 11 (23 November 2004), lot 354.
